响应式布局:移动端与PC端的完美结合

作者:起个名字好难2024.02.16 01:42浏览量:6

简介:响应式布局是一种能够自动适应不同设备和屏幕尺寸的网页设计方法。本文将介绍常见的响应式布局方案,包括移动端和PC端的考虑因素,以及如何实现完美的结合。

在当今的互联网时代,移动设备和PC都在争夺用户的注意力。为了提供更好的用户体验,响应式布局已成为网页设计的必备技能。它可以根据不同的设备和屏幕尺寸自动调整网页的布局和样式,以适应各种场景。在实现响应式布局时,我们需要考虑移动端和PC端的不同需求和特点,以确保最佳的用户体验。

移动优先是响应式布局的核心思想之一。由于移动设备的屏幕尺寸较小,我们需要优先考虑移动端的布局和样式。通过使用媒体查询,我们可以为不同的屏幕尺寸定义不同的样式规则。这样,当用户在不同设备上访问网页时,系统会自动加载适合该设备的样式,提供更加舒适和易用的界面。

在PC端,由于屏幕尺寸较大,我们可以使用更大的字体和间距来提高可读性和易用性。此外,PC端用户通常需要更多的信息和功能,因此我们可以使用更多的列和卡片来展示内容。通过使用百分比、rem等相对单位,我们可以实现灵活的布局和样式调整,以满足不同设备的显示需求。

视口单位是响应式布局中的另一个重要概念。通过使用vw、vh等视口单位,我们可以根据浏览器窗口的宽度和高度来定义元素的尺寸和位置。这样,无论用户如何缩放浏览器窗口,网页的内容都能够自适应调整大小和位置,提供一致的视觉效果。

在实现响应式布局时,我们还需要注意一些细节问题。例如,在PC端和移动端上的交互方式可能不同,因此我们需要根据设备类型调整按钮、链接等元素的样式和行为。另外,由于不同设备的像素密度不同,我们还需要使用媒体查询来定义不同像素密度的样式规则,以确保图片、背景等元素的显示效果更加清晰和细腻。

在实际开发中,我们可以使用一些工具和框架来简化响应式布局的实现过程。例如,Bootstrap、Foundation等前端框架提供了丰富的组件和样式规则,可以帮助我们快速构建响应式布局。此外,我们还应该注意性能优化,例如使用CDN加速图片的加载速度、压缩CSS和JavaScript文件等措施,以提高网页的加载速度和用户体验。

综上所述,实现响应式布局需要综合考虑移动端和PC端的不同需求和特点。通过使用媒体查询、相对单位和视口单位等技术手段,我们可以实现自适应的布局和样式调整,提供一致的用户体验。同时,我们还应该注意性能优化和其他细节问题,以确保最佳的用户体验。通过不断地实践和探索,我们可以创造出更加优秀和创新的响应式布局方案,为用户带来更加美好的网页浏览体验。